Nestled just a brief drive from Perth, the Swan Valley stands as a homage to Western Australia's rich viticultural heritage. This region is renowned for its varied selection of regional a glass of wine selections, which prosper in the abundant soils and desirable climate. Secret varietals consist of lavish Semillon and fragrant Chenin Blanc, both commemorated for their quality and vibrant tastes. The valley likewise creates durable Cabernet Sauvignon and sophisticated Shiraz, showcasing the unique terroir of the area. White wine enthusiasts usually go to neighborhood wineries for samplings, appreciating the splendid blends crafted by proficient vintners. With a dedication to lasting techniques, the Swan Valley continues to advance, attracting both aficionados and laid-back enthusiasts keen to explore its remarkable offerings in the globe of wine.
